    Since I live in an area very similar to Oasis Springs IRL, I love the worlds in game that are different from what I'm personally accustomed to. My favorite world would probably have to be Windenburg. I adore Tudor-style architecture and I really like the way the quaint, scenic areas contrast against the more modern sections of town. Windenburg also seems to be so rich with history; I love seeing the ruins that can be found throughout the world. Brindleton Bay is also very beautiful with its Cape Cod style architecture and colorful foliage. I'd probably struggle to choose between the two, but I'd most likely end up going with Windenburg in the end. I love how immersive and charming it is.

    However, if I could live in Selvadorada, I just might. The snakes and giant spiders may deter me a bit, but that place is gorgeous! :heart: I'd just have to carry bug repellent 24/7. :lol:
